Surgeries and Consultations
Do you have a child in KS1 or KS2 that you are concerned about that is not responding to the whole school behaviour policy or any reasonable adjustments made?
Gedling Area Partnership offer surgeries and consultations.
- School contact GAP team for anonymous advice on a child with presenting SEMH needs
- School invited to a surgery to discuss the graduated response and presenting need
- A signed parent/carer consent for discussion form will be required to request a consultation with GAP to enable a more in-depth discussion around the child and their presenting need. This is done using our booking system which is under the "How to access support" tab.
- Schools can request direct involvement for children who will benefit from a bespoke package of support, following evidence of progression through the graduated response. A request for involvement form and consent from parent/carers will be required. School will then be invited to attend an operational meeting where appropriate support with be identified This will be reviewed six weekly with school and parents/carers
Please note we cannot offer this to children who are already accessing support to school services without prior discussion.
